Risk Management in Trading Using AI Insights

 

Risk Management in Trading Using AI Insights

The most crucial aspect of trading is risk management. Many traders fail due to poor risk management rather than flawed analysis. Data-driven and structured risk management is made easier for traders with the aid of AI insights. Risk is not eliminated by AI. It aids in your comprehension and management of it.

Risk management using AI emphasizes probability rather than prediction. To determine the riskiness of a trade in the present, it examines market data. This enables traders to make well-informed choices rather than impulsive ones.

Volatility analysis is one of the primary ways AI aids in risk management. Volatility demonstrates the speed and range of price movements. Risk increases with high volatility. Slower movement is the result of low volatility. Real-time volatility is measured by AI systems. They recommend smaller position sizes in volatile markets based on this data. This shields the trading account from unexpectedly high losses.

One of the fundamental ideas of risk management is position sizing. Fixed lot sizes are used by many traders, which is risky. Position size is determined by AI tools using stop loss distance, volatility, and account balance. This ensures that risk is constant throughout trades. The account is not severely harmed by losing one trade.

AI insights improve stop loss placement. Stop losses are frequently made by manual traders at random or out of emotion. AI finds logical stop zones by analyzing past price behavior. Data, not hope, is the basis for these zones. The likelihood of being stopped out by typical market noise is decreased with proper stop loss placement.

AI aids in risk-to-reward analysis as  well. The system weighs potential gains and losses before making a trade. The trade is marked as low quality if the reward does not outweigh the risk. This instructs traders to concentrate on High probability opportunities and steer clear of bad setups.

Another effective component of AI risk management is drawdown control. The drop from the account's peak to its lowest point is known as a drawdown. AI programs monitor drawdown trends and notify traders when losses surpass acceptable thresholds. After a certain loss threshold, some tools advise ceasing trading. This stops trading in emotional retaliation.

Filtering market conditions is a crucial AI function. Not every tactic is effective in every situation. AI can determine if the market is ranging, trending, or extremely volatile. It alerts traders when their approach is inappropriate based on this. One effective method of risk management is to avoid unfavorable circumstances.

Diversification is also supported by AI insights. Exposure rises when risk is concentrated on a single asset. AI examines the relationship between markets and assets. It assists traders in avoiding making several trades at once. This lowers the overall risk of the portfolio.

Another advantage is time-based risk control. AI investigates the duration of open trades. AI indicates a higher risk if a trade moves more slowly than anticipated. Emotional exits or abrupt reversals are frequently the result of stagnant trades. Trade discipline is enhanced by time analysis.

Psychological risk is frequently disregarded. Most losses are the result of greed and fear. AI algorithms eliminate emotion from computations. They adhere to predetermined rules and logic. In times of stress, this aids traders in staying true to their plan. Long-term consistency is enhanced by less emotional involvement.

Post-trade analysis can benefit from AI insights. AI Examines performance data after trades close. It finds trends in both wins and losses. Traders discover which configurations raise and lower risk. Future decision-making is strengthened by this feedback loop.

Trading platforms like TradingView allow you to use AI-driven indicators that plot potential risk levels and volatility zones. They allow you to visualize what can sometimes be difficult risk concepts. They are Practical for novices and seasoned traders alike.

AI can assist with educational risk planning Too. Many traders use AI Chat bots like ChatGPT to learn about risk models, position sizing formulas, and scenario planning. This should be used for learning and Education. I do not use it for live trade risk decisions.
